How Rocklin's conditions form a great design

Production in Rocklin is excellent. A south or southwest array at a 15 to 25 degree tilt can produce roughly 1,400 to 1,700 kilowatt hours each year for each and every kilowatt of DC ability. A 7 kW system typically lands between 9,800 and 11,500 kWh each year, presuming low shading and efficient tools. Microclimates exist along the I‑80 passage, but the swing is moderate contrasted to seaside fog belts.

The roof covering kinds matter more than individuals believe. Lots of Rocklin homes have concrete S‑tile or level floor tile, and others have asphalt structure roof shingles. Tile work need either a floor tile hook system with flashed places or a full or partial comp‑out under the variety. That choice affects expense, timeline, and roof covering service warranty. The cleanest long‑term technique when tiles are brittle is a partial comp‑out under the variety impact, with new underlayment and composite tiles tucked under the surrounding ceramic tiles. It looks clean, it minimizes factor tons on old ceramic tiles, and it generally extends the waterproofing under the panels by 20 to thirty years. A quick floor tile lift might be more affordable up front, but I have actually replaced too many split floor tiles around places after a couple of hot summers.

Shading is the silent killer. Rocklin has lots of two‑story neighbors and backyard trees that toss winter months darkness throughout north edges of roofings. An installer needs to run a color evaluation with an electronic tool, not just eyeball it. If you do not see a solstice or horizon graph in your proposition package, ask for it. The distinction in between 8 percent and 18 percent yearly shade is the distinction in between a system that pencils out and one that does not.

What NEM 3.0 implies for Rocklin homeowners

California's Web Energy Metering 3.0 altered the math. Exported solar power earns reduced debts based on hourly worths, so daytime exports on light springtime days can be worth cents, while night imports are expensive. The takeaway is straightforward. Self‑consumption issues. Batteries are not mandatory, however they commonly make good sense now.

Most Rocklin addresses sit in PG&E territory. A few pockets near city boundaries might have various service, yet if your costs states PG&E, you get on a time‑of‑use price after interconnection. Under these prices, making use of solar energy as it is produced and changing the rest to evening with storage space boosts savings. A common 10 kWh battery can soak up lunchtime excess and cover the 4 to 9 pm height. I see the greatest value when a home's annual usage is 8,000 to 14,000 kWh, air conditioning is the major driver, and you can program thermostats to pre‑cool in the afternoon.

If you are within Roseville Electric service, policies differ and export worths can be extra desirable at particular hours. Always have the installer quote your actual energy rate routine and show a with‑battery and without‑battery forecast. Search for hourly modeling, not just a single annual number.

The right dimension for your home

Two houses with the very same square video can have wildly various demands. The right photovoltaic panel installment size originates from your usage background, not from the number of roof planes. Any kind of solar panel installers worth their permit will certainly request year of costs or an Environment-friendly Switch data download. Excellent propositions anchor to kWh, after that readjust for direct changes such as an EV acquisition, a swimming pool pump upgrade, or a heatpump conversion. In Rocklin, an EV driven 8,000 to 10,000 miles yearly includes approximately 2,000 to 3,000 kWh per year, which is 1.5 to 2.5 kW of added array capacity.

Tilt and orientation changes matter too. If your best roofing system is due west, a slightly bigger array can offset the lower yearly yield, and west can be beneficial for late afternoon production that aligns with peak rates. If your only sensible roofing system is eastern and shaded in wintertime mornings, lean a lot more on combined storage space or accept that the payback will certainly lengthen.

Equipment choices that fit Rocklin roofs

I have installed the majority of the mainstream panel and inverter brand names in Northern The golden state. A couple of practical notes for our environment and roofing types:

    Panels: Qcells, REC, and Canadian Solar have been constant performers in the 400 to 430 watt variety. SunPower offers greater effectiveness components with streamlined aesthetics, valuable on little, highly visible roofs, however at a premium. Heat derates are genuine in July and August, so inspect the temperature coefficient. A distinction of 0.1 percent per level Celsius builds up in a Rocklin warm wave. Inverters: Enphase microinverters pair well with complex or shaded roofs and tile overlays. Module‑level MPPT manages partial shielding gracefully and simplifies quick shutdown. SolarEdge optimizers with a main inverter are effective on straightforward roof aircrafts and can be cost‑effective for bigger systems. Both options fulfill The golden state fast closure requirements. Racking and places: On tile, try to find blinked, tested installs and stainless equipment. On composite shingles, a flashed L‑foot with a butyl or steel blinking is typical. Request item cut sheets in the submittal package. If you can not find a UL 2703 listing for the racking system, that is a problem. Batteries: Tesla Powerwall, Enphase Intelligence Battery, and FranklinWH are the most common in my jobs. Tesla's community is fully grown with tidy back-up switchover. Enphase appeals if you like one supplier for microinverters and storage. Hardware expense per usable kWh in 2026 frequently falls in between 900 and 1,400 bucks prior to motivations, with mounted system cost driven by major panel upgrades and electrical wiring runs.

Permitting and assessments in Rocklin

The City of Rocklin has streamlined solar permitting under The golden state's Solar Civil liberty Act and associated regulation. Residential solar licenses are typically managed over-the-counter or online. Fees are covered by state legislation for typical residential systems, so be unconvinced if a professional condemns big permit fees for a high price.

Fire problems use. Inspectors typically seek 36 inch pathways on 1 or 2 roof edges for firefighter ingress, though specifics depend on roofing system dimension and arrangement. A proposition that loads every square foot of roof covering frequently gets cut at strategy check. A skilled developer recognizes to keep sufficient clear roofing location near ridges and hips to prevent redraws.

Inspections in Rocklin are specialist and comprehensive. Expect the examiner to seek proper conductor sizing, labeling, bonding, and proper roof covering flashing. The more image documents your installer sends and brings to site, the quicker this step relocations. I keep a folder of roofing system penetration photos, junction box seals, and conductor terminations to show an examiner if required, which conserves re‑inspections.

Interconnection and the PG&E timeline

After assessment and meter launch, your installer sends affiliation paperwork. In PG&E territory, the Authorization to Run letter can extract from a few days to a number of weeks depending on workload. Clean one‑line layouts, appropriate service panel pictures, and exact meter numbers shorten the cycle. If you listen to generalities like "sometime following month" without any portal condition or reference number, push for specifics. For the majority of simple domestic tasks, 2 to 4 weeks is common.

If your home requires a primary circuit box upgrade from 100 amps to 200 amps, anticipate more sychronisation. PG&E solution work adds actions and can press the routine by several weeks. Often a lots calculation and a bus‑bar rating change with a supply‑side tap can avoid a complete upgrade. A competent solar business will evaluate that trade‑off versus long‑term safety and future lots like an EV charger.

Pricing and rewards in California right now

Installed expenses for solar energy setup in Rocklin differ with roof covering type, complexity, and equipment. In 2026, I frequently see money rates for high quality systems in the 2.80 to 4.00 bucks per watt array before motivations. Tile roofs, complex 2nd stories, and long channel runs nudge costs greater. Batteries add substantial expense, commonly 10,000 to 18,000 bucks per unit mounted, influenced by electrical job and back-up scope.

The 30 percent government Investment Tax Credit score still puts on domestic solar and batteries paired with solar. The golden state's Self‑Generation Incentive Program uses battery incentives that differ by classification and budget action. Equity Resiliency can be very generous for certified customers in high fire hazard areas or with medical standard and recent interruptions. In the Rocklin area, a lot of consumers come under the basic market category, which lowers battery cost decently. Your installer should confirm SGIP accessibility at the time of agreement rather than thinking funds are there.

Financing alternatives, if you are not paying cash money, include safeguarded or unprotected solar finances, and in many cases leases or power purchase arrangements. Under NEM 3.0, leases and PPAs can function, yet they typically constrict system changes and make complex battery add‑ons. Funding items differ commonly on dealer costs. A 2.99 percent "intro" APR with a 20 percent supplier charge costs more than a market‑rate HELOC over the life of the system. Request for a cash rate and afterwards a funded rate with all costs revealed, side by side.

How to veterinarian solar business Rocklin homeowners can count on

Licensing is non‑negotiable. In The golden state, look for a C‑46 Solar Specialist license or a C‑10 Electrical Service provider permit in excellent standing with the Professionals State Permit Board. Examine whether the business name on the contract matches the qualified entity. Ask for proof of basic responsibility and employees' compensation insurance. If they utilize subcontractors for roof covering or electrical work, those belows need proper licenses and insurance coverage as well.

NABCEP qualification is a significant signal for style and installation staff. It is not needed, however when I see a NABCEP PV Installment Professional on the group, I anticipate cleaner electric information and much better troubleshooting.

Longevity matters, yet brand acquisitions obscure background. A business that has operated in Rocklin for 5 years with the very same certificate and a track record of neighborhood examinations is extra calming than a new franchise business with out‑of‑state monitoring. Ask how many systems they have actually installed in your ZIP code and demand addresses you can drive by. Excellent installers take pride in their rooftops.

Service action is where business differentiate themselves. The very first summer tornado that drives rain sidewards will certainly evaluate every roofing infiltration. I maintain butyl spots, spare tiles, and sealer in the vehicle therefore. Ask exactly how guarantee tickets are taken care of, what the average response time is, and whether they equip usual microinverters and optimizers for quick swaps.

Comparing propositions without getting lost in the weeds

Proposals can be hard to compare since every solar supplier structures worth differently. Concentrate on a few supports. Annual kWh production should be designed with shading and alignment used. Inspect the assumed system losses, generally 12 to 18 percent. If one proposal shows considerably greater manufacturing for the same array dimension and layout, dig into the assumptions.

Warranties differ. PaneI item warranties of 12 to 25 years are common, performance warranties encompass 25 years with a straight deterioration curve. Inverter and optimizer guarantees normally run 10 to 25 years depending upon brand name and extensions. Labor warranties are the soft place. A 25 year item warranty does not pay for a truck roll unless the installer covers labor or you acquire a prolonged labor strategy. Request for labor coverage in writing.

Roofing details need to be specific. Floor tile job methods, underlayment kind under a comp‑out, and paint of avenue are little things that forecast finish quality. I still see outside channel running over a ridge when it can have dropped easily right into an attic. That conserves an hour today and looks like a second thought for decades.

What a practical timeline looks like

From signed contract to Consent to Operate, an uncomplicated Rocklin task usually runs 6 to 12 weeks. The variety relies on roofing system work, battery range, main panel upgrades, permit timing, and energy affiliation. If a company quotes three weeks door to door, ask which steps they are missing. On the various other severe, a 4 month timeline without any main panel job or battery usually suggests staffing bottlenecks.

Weather hold-ups are rare here, yet summertime warmth can limit rooftop hours for security. Excellent teams phase early morning work on south roofing system planes and shift to attic electrical wiring later in the day. I write that right into the routine when the projection asks for triple digits.

When a battery pays and when it does not

Batteries supply 3 distinct values. They change energy from low‑value midday exports to high‑value evening intake, they give backup throughout blackouts, and they can lower demand charges on certain business tariffs. In PG&E household time‑of‑use, batteries paired with solar rise savings under NEM 3.0, yet the magnitude relies on use pattern.

If your home is empty from early morning to night and your optimal tons are air conditioner and food preparation from 5 to 9 pm, a 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can materially boost cost savings and comfort. If you work from home and already run home appliances during solar hours, the step-by-step worth is smaller, and the battery tilts more towards backup. Hatred outages is individual. Some clients will certainly pay a premium to maintain the heating and cooling, lights, web, and refrigerator going through wildfire‑related shutoffs, also if the repayment extends by two or three years.

I encourage clients to map vital tons meticulously. Whole‑home back-up appears eye-catching, yet it can compel upsized batteries and a main panel upgrade. A subpanel with vital circuits, or a smart tons controller, commonly strikes the best balance. Ask your installer to define precisely which circuits remain on throughout a grid outage.

The duty of professional roofer in a long‑lasting install

Solar panel set up work sits on top of one of the most vulnerable component of your house. Flashing information and underlayment are not extravagant, but they maintain you completely dry. On older tile roofings, I bring a roofing professional for a half day to change cracked ceramic tiles prior to rails rise. That visit sets you back a few hundred dollars and stays clear of solution telephone calls after the first winter months tornado. On composition roof shingles roofs nearing end of life, I like to re‑roof under the range footprint at minimum. Pulling a variety in ten years to re‑roof is a lot more pricey than doing it right at the start.

Do not gloss over penetrations on low‑slope or outdoor patio covers. Some add‑on outdoor patio roofing systems are not architectural members developed to bring solar loads, or they make use of treatments that do not play well with conventional flashings. A structural letter from an engineer is cheap insurance coverage in those cases.

Red flags I look for in solar installment companies near me

Pricing that is much listed below market can mean devices substitutions or marginal service after the sale. A salesperson who leans on a limited‑time rebate without allowing you review the contract is another red flag. Search for specificity. If a quote simply says 24 panels and a battery, without model numbers or format, that is not an actual design.

Another indication is an absence of as‑builts after installation. You deserve an as‑built format with identification numbers, a one‑line layout that matches the final install, and photos. When a company can not generate those within a week of last inspection, assistance often tends to experience later.

Finally, beware with change orders. Some contractors lowball electric work, then include a surprise major panel upgrade on site. A proper pre‑site go to with panel pictures and conductor sizes avoids that. If an adjustment is genuinely needed, you ought to see the lots calc or code recommendation that drives it.

Realistic assumptions for maintenance and monitoring

Modern systems require little routine upkeep beyond periodic aesthetic checks and a panel clean if required. Rocklin dirt builds in summer season. On low‑tilt varieties, a light clean a few times each year can recover a handful of percent factors in production. Do not treat components with extreme chemicals. A soft brush on an extension pole and deionized water, if offered, functions well. Early morning is best, when the glass is cool.

Monitoring is your good friend. Enphase and SolarEdge apps show module‑level data. I recommend clients to look monthly, not daily. If production drops dramatically on a bright day without any good factor, call solution. Establish e-mail alerts for inverter mistakes. Batteries also have software program updates. Maintain your gateway online and let the installer deal with firmware pushes.

Inverters and optimizers can fail, although rarely. Plan on a tiny part replacement at some point in a 25 year life. Labor protection makes that a non‑event as opposed to a costly visit.

When to stroll away

Sometimes the roof is at the end of its life and needs work initially. If the underlayment under floor tile is breakable or make-up tiles are cupping, take on that before including solar. On heavy color lots where trees are safeguarded or cherished, a smaller selection for partial countered plus a battery for back-up may be the appropriate call. In unusual instances, waiting makes sense. If you prepare a major remodel with a new major solution or a reroof within a year, time the photovoltaic panel setup to comply with the roof.
